It has been a five-and-a-half year wait since the debut of this large ensemble co-led by Anna Webber and Angela Morris on saxes and flutes. Both Are True, released in early 2020, was an album of the year. So did they do it again with Unseparate? Yeah, they did.
Webber and Morris lead their outfit through a varied set of harmonic and rhythmic structures, including drones, staccato blasts, soaring melodies that become spiky, and dense contrapuntal passages. The Big Band includes four additional players on woodwinds, four on trumpets, four on trombones, and individuals on vibraphone, guitar, piano, bass, and drums.
